Common mistake

Misunderstanding Carbon Dioxide's Role

Students often think that increasing carbon dioxide concentration will always lead to a higher rate of photosynthesis without considering other limiting factors.

Emphasize that while carbon dioxide is essential for photosynthesis, its effect is dependent on other factors such as light intensity and temperature. Ensure to explain the concept of limiting factors in photosynthesis.
